Course Information

Tonbridge Golf Centre, Kent is a 9 hole, par 54 (2254 yard), public, parkland golf course established in 2006

9 holes | Par 54 | 2254 yards | Public | Parkland

I use this course on a regular basis and it is a great course more so if you are a beginner or just want to improve your skills. It cost £5 a round, which is pretty good and the course has improved a lot. Some of the greens are not perfect but some of that has been down to people chipping on the greens bt it is getting better. The range is good if you want to practice hitting some balls and there is a great cafe at the location.
